9th meeting of the Belarusian-Hungarian Intergovernmental Commission on Economic Cooperation

On November 6, 2018 Minsk hosted the ninth meeting of the Belarusian-Hungarian Intergovernmental Commission for Economic Cooperation.

The Belarusian delegation was headed by the Deputy Minister of Foreign Affairs, Oleg Kravchenko, the Hungarian delegation was led by the State Secretary of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Trade, Csaba Balogh.

Representatives of different ministries, governmental institutions, chambers of commerce, business communities of the two countries took part in the work of the commission.

During the meeting, the parties analyzed the results of joint work over the past year in the field of trade, economic and investment cooperation, discussed the prospects and priorities for further development of economic cooperation, including the collaboration in such areas as agriculture, construction, standardization and metrology, education, science and innovation, cooperation between the capitals of the two countries.

The parties signed a final Protocol of the meeting of the Intergovernmental Commission and a Plan of Activities for the implementation of the Memorandum of Understanding between the national accreditation centers of the two countries.

On November 6, 2018, the Belarusian-Hungarian Business Forum was held in the Belarusian Chamber of Commerce and Industry, which gathered more than twenty businessmen from both countries interested in establishing direct contacts.
